Thinking of doing a day trip tomorrow.

Saturdays three years ago, Trowbridge to Waterloo.

Direct train at 09:27, 13:37 and 16:30
Arriving Waterloo at 11:49, 15:49 and 18:49

I have looked at Trowbridge to Waterloo for tomorrow 23.10.2021 ("not via Paddington")



Don't think I'll bother ...
